Don’t get me wrong; this Mac & Cheese is good just the way it is! When cooking macaroni slowly in a crock-pot or a low oven I always try and use gluten-free macaroni. It holds up better, freezes well, and I have yet to have it turn mushy. This makes enough for you and your family, or enough to scoop up into containers and freeze for future lunches. 8 ounces, plus ½ cup of dry, gluten-free pasta. I like to mix shells and elbow pasta.
2 ¾ cup fat-free milk
4 tablespoons butter
2 ¼ cup shredded cheese – Sharp cheddar works great in this recipe.
¼ cup Parmassan cheese
4 ounces low-fat cream cheese
1 egg
1-teaspoon celery salt
2 teaspoon dried parsley
1 cup crushed potato chips or corn flakes – optional
Spray a 3-quart slow-cooker with cooking spray, sides and bottom
Place macaroni into crock-pot.
Heat milk on high in microwave 3 minutes or until very warm.
Chop up the cream cheese and stir into milk until it starts to dissolve. Crack the egg in small bowl and whisk. Whisk into milk and cream cheese mixture. Pour over macaroni in crock-pot. Cut butter into small pieces and stir into macaroni mixture. Add 2 cups of shredded cheese and Parmesan cheese to crock-pot and stir well.
Add ¼ cup shredded cheese to the one cup crushed potato chips and spoon over macaroni and cheese.
Spray a sheet of foil with cooking spray. Cover slow cooker with foil so the foil is right on the macaroni mixture and place lid on your slow-cooker.
*Set crock-pot to low and cook 6 hours.
*This is great to plug into an electrical timer that will turn your crock-pot off after 6 hours. Your Mac & Cheese will be warm when you get home, or it is easy to reheat in the microwave. Do not cook longer than 6 hours.
